Transaction 76a68482c0c0c35e980e35c1689d94c918054382c5c25d5e3b78320094a7213a
1 Input
1 Output
-
76a68482c0c0c35e980e35c1689d94c918054382c5c25d5e3b78320094a7213a:0
- value
- 67734
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b50044f595aea9cb3c33c42e6e5153ec0d7d53c
- address
- bc1q8dgqgn6ett4fev7r83pwdeg48mqd04fut4npvz